**Ticket: Config drift on tilecacher-prefetch**

Hey, flagging this for security review. The map-tile prefetcher on the Brundle cluster has drifted from what's in the Lanternworks repo — someone hand-edited the fetch concurrency and the allowed-origin list back in spring and never committed it. We only noticed when the Varga staging env behaved differently from prod. Nothing looks malicious, but the origin allowlist change is worth your eyes. I've dumped the live running config below so you can diff it against the repo.

service settings:
wenix:
  pin: 0857
  metrics_host: metrics.wenix.lumiclabs.internal
  tenant: ulavan
  seal: seal_db298014

## Runbook: Dark Mode Rollout — Ostrel Admin Dashboard

Hey reviewer — quick notes before you approve. Dark mode in the Ostrel dashboard is gated behind the `theme.dark` flag, default off in prod. Styles come from the shared token set, so don't let anyone hand-roll hex values in component CSS. If contrast checks fail in the pipeline, the merge blocks automatically. To flip it on for staging, bump the flag in the theme config and redeploy. Confirm your test run against the trace token below.

pipeline stamp: htk4_662c

Subject: Order-cutoff rule — ownership change

Team,

Heads up for new joiners: the Crumbline bakery platform enforces a 6 p.m. cutoff for next-day orders. The rule lives in the scheduling service, not the storefront — don't patch it in the UI. Cutoff changes require a config ticket plus one approval. Effective Monday, ownership of this rule and its approval queue moves off my plate. The new responsible party is named below.

named custodian: Brivan Eliath Quenox Frador

## Dedupe on-call alerts before paging

Adds a deduplication layer to Pagewisp so identical alerts within a window collapse into one notification. Hashing uses alert source, rule ID, and normalized payload — no raw payload stored. Window state lives in Quillcache with TTL eviction; nothing persisted to disk. Auth path unchanged; dedupe runs post-authz. Suppressed alerts are still logged for audit. Please review the hashing scope and the cache TTL handling for replay concerns. Tuning values below.

constants for bagaf-hadup:
QUOTAS = {
    "quenael": 1,
    "ralwyn": 1,
    "oliath": 2,
    "ulaael": 2,
}